Аптекарский проспект 2
В команду ООО "Градиация" (https://gradiation.ru/) требуется iOS-разработчик для участия в разработке мобильного приложения, которое управляет медицинскими устройствами и используется людьми с диабетом в повседневной жизни.
Стек: SwiftUI, MVVM, Clean Architecture, Swift Concurrency, CoreBluetooth, CoreData, WebSocket, Swift Testing, Tuist
Основные задачи:
-
Разработка и поддержка iOS-приложения для медицинских устройств;
-
Реализация пользовательских сценариев, связанных с отображением и обработкой медицинских данных;
-
Интеграция мобильного приложения с серверным API и устройствами;
-
Участие в проработке технических решений совместно с командой;
-
Поддержка и доработка существующего функционала;
-
Взаимодействие с QA и другими разработчиками.
Требования:
- Опыт разработки под iOS от 2-3 лет;
- Отличное знание Swift;
- Понимание принципов построения iOS-приложений;
- Опыт работы с локальными хранилищами данных (CoreData / SQLite);
- Умение работать с веб-сервисами по API;
- Глубокое понимание ООП, принципов SOLID и паттернов проектирования;
- Умение декомпозировать и формализовывать задачи;
- Понимание принципов асинхронного и многопоточного программирования;
- Опыт работы с системами контроля версий (Git);
- Понимание жизненного цикла разработки ПО.
Будет плюсом:
- Опыт разработки с использованием технологии Bluetooth;
- Опыт работы с медицинскими или IoT-устройствами;
- Опыт разработки приложений, работающих с графиками и данными в реальном времени;
- Опыт публикации приложений в App Store.
Условия работы:
- Полный рабочий день, трудоустройство согласно ТД РФ;
- Комфортабельный офис с видом на ботанический сад недалеко от м. Петроградская;
- Участие в проекте ориентированном на внедрение современных стандартов в диабетологии;
- Конкурентная оплата, гибкий подход к задачам;
- Возможность влиять на развитие продукта на ранних этапах;
- Участие в проектах, которые действительно улучшают жизнь людей!